idbql: a queryable IndexedDB wrapper
idbql is a library for interacting with IndexedDB in the browser.
It provides a simple interface for creating, reading, updating, and deleting data in an IndexedDB database.
it provides a stateful indexedDB wrapper with a queryable interface on top of svelte 5 : it's live !
Installation
You can install this library using npm:
npm install idbql
Classes
DataBase
Define your types
export type Chat = {
id?: number;
chatId?: string;
title?: string;
models?: string[];
};
export type ChatMessage = {
id?: string;
chatId: string;
messageId?: string;
content?: string;
};
-
Create your model to define your collections, while preserving typescript features to provide autocomplete features.
The syntax for defining your model is as follows:
&
: Indicates that the field is an index. Indexed fields can be used for faster searching.
++
: Indicates that the field is an auto-incrementing primary key.
const idbqModel = {
chat: {
keyPath: "&chatId, created_at, dateLastMessage",
model: {} as Chat,
},
messages: {
keyPath: "++id, chatId, created_at",
model: {} as ChatMessage,
},
} as const;
-
Instantiate your database with the model and the version of your database.
const idbq = idbqBase<typeof idbqModel>(idbqModel, 1);
export const dbase = idbq("testDatabase");
Usage
To use this library, create a new instance of DataBase
:
const idbq = idbqBase<typeof idbqModel>(idbqModel, 1);
export const dbase = idbq("testDatabase");
You can then use dbase
to interact with your IndexedDB database.
Collections (Tables)
The collections store your data.
You can interact with them using the following methods:
Methods
dbase.chat.add({ chatId: 5, title: "name" });
dbase.chat.put({ chatId: 5, context: [121, 253] });
dbase.chat.get(5);
dbase.chat.getOne(5);
dbase.chat.getAll();
dbase.chat.delete(5);
dbase.chat.deleteWhere({ chatId: 5, title: "name" });
dbase.chat.clear();
dbase.chat.count();
where(query: object)
The where()
method filters the collection based on a set of criteria. The method takes an object as a parameter, where each key is a field name and the value is another object specifying the operator and value to filter by.
dbase.chat.where({ chatId: { eq: 5 } });
These methods provide a simple and intuitive interface for interacting with your IndexedDB database.
Operators
The Operators
class provides a set of comparison operators for filtering data:
eq
: Equality comparison
gt
: Greater than comparison
gte
: Greater than or equal to comparison
lt
: Less than comparison
lte
: Less than or equal to comparison
ne
: Not equal comparison
in
: Inclusion in a list comparison
nin
: Exclusion from a list comparison
contains
: Checks if a value is contained in a field
startsWith
: Checks if a field starts with a value
endsWith
: Checks if a field ends with a value
